Stealth Origami Inc is a creative company based in The Villages, FL, specializing in the art of origami. They offer a range of services and products related to the ancient paper-folding technique.
With a focus on precision and attention to detail, Stealth Origami Inc provides unique and custom origami creations for various occasions and purposes. Their skilled artisans bring a touch of elegance and craftsmanship to each piece they create.
Generated from their business information